美文网首页
C语言 计算100以内的素数

C语言 计算100以内的素数

作者: 863cda997e42 | 来源:发表于2018-02-08 15:16 被阅读45次
    #include <stdio.h>
     
    bool isPrime(int num);
    
    int main()
    {
        for(int i = 2; i < 100; i++)
        {
            if(isPrime(i)){
                printf("%d is prime.\n", i);
            }
        }
        return 0;
    }
    
    bool isPrime(int num)
    {
        for(int i = 2; i < num; i++)
        {
            if(num % i == 0)
            {
                return false;
            }
        }
        return true;
    }
    

    结果如下:

    2 is prime.
    3 is prime.
    5 is prime.
    7 is prime.
    11 is prime.
    13 is prime.
    17 is prime.
    19 is prime.
    23 is prime.
    29 is prime.
    31 is prime.
    37 is prime.
    41 is prime.
    43 is prime.
    47 is prime.
    53 is prime.
    59 is prime.
    61 is prime.
    67 is prime.
    71 is prime.
    73 is prime.
    79 is prime.
    83 is prime.
    89 is prime.
    97 is prime.
    Press any key to continue
    

    相关文章

      网友评论

          本文标题:C语言 计算100以内的素数

          本文链接:https://www.haomeiwen.com/subject/xeyttftx.html